What is a Consultant Psychiatrist?
A consultant psychiatrist is a medical doctor who concentrates on detecting and dealing with mental health conditions. They have actually completed extensive training in psychiatry and are equipped to manage complicated cases. Unlike general professionals, consultant psychiatrists can prescribe medications and offer different healing interventions.

1. How do I understand if I need a psychiatrist?It's a good idea to seek assistance if you're experiencing prolonged distress, disruptions in daily life, or if you've been recommended by another healthcare service provider.

2. What's the difference in between a psychiatrist and a psychologist?Psychiatrists are medical doctors who can prescribe medication and provide a broader variety of treatment options. Psychologists generally offer therapy however can not prescribe medication.

3. For how long does treatment normally take?The duration of treatment differs substantially from person to person, depending upon the complexity of the concerns and treatment action.

4. What should I give my very first consultation?Bring any previous medical records connected to mental health, a list of medications you're presently taking, and any concerns you may have.

5. Is treatment confidential?Yes, mental health treatments are personal, and psychiatrists follow strict ethical standards regarding privacy.
